Naoufal Bannis Discusses Mental Health and Football Pressure
Naoufal Bannis, a professional footballer, has spoken out about the importance of mental health in an interview with VI PRO. He shares his own experiences of struggling with the pressure of playing for a top club and highlights the need for players to seek help when needed.

Bannis has spoken with Gianni Zuiverloon, who shares his own experiences, and believes this helps him greatly. He works with a mental coach and thinks it's essential for young players to seek help when needed. Bannis also thinks it's crucial that players don't feel ashamed to seek help, stating that it should be viewed as a normal part of football. He wants young players to do what they think they need to do and not be afraid to speak out.
Bannis is currently scoring well, having scored six goals in five matches, and aims to take Vitesse to the next level. He believes having confidence and consistently backing it up is key.
